溫馨提示×

hadoop數據平衡命令

小云
269
2023-10-11 09:36:24
欄目: 大數據

Hadoop中可以使用以下命令來實現數據平衡:

  1. HDFS Balancer命令:用于將數據中的塊均勻地分布到集群中的不同節點上??梢允褂靡韵旅顏磉\行Balancer:
hdfs balancer [-threshold <threshold>]

參數說明:

  • -threshold <threshold>:可選參數,指定數據塊遷移的閾值,默認為10。如果某個節點上的數據塊數量與平均值之間的差異超過閾值,則會觸發數據塊遷移。
  1. HDFS Rebalancer命令:用于重新平衡HDFS集群中的數據塊。與Balancer命令不同的是,Rebalancer命令可以在運行時指定要調整的目標數據塊數量??梢允褂靡韵旅顏磉\行Rebalancer:
hdfs dfsadmin -rebalance [-threshold <threshold>] [-bandwidth <bandwidth>]

參數說明:

  • -threshold <threshold>:可選參數,指定數據塊遷移的閾值,默認為10。如果某個節點上的數據塊數量與目標值之間的差異超過閾值,則會觸發數據塊遷移。

  • -bandwidth <bandwidth>:可選參數,指定數據塊遷移的帶寬限制,默認為0。如果指定了帶寬限制,數據塊遷移的速度將受到限制。

需要注意的是,數據平衡操作可能會對集群的性能產生一定影響,因此在進行數據平衡操作時需要謹慎考慮。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女